Susquehanna Fundamental Investments LLC purchased a new stake in Revolution Medicines, Inc. (NASDAQ:RVMD - Free Report) during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m purchased 228,513 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$9,995,000. Susquehanna Fundamental Investments LLC owned approximately 0.14% of Revolution Medicines as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Revolution Medicines, Inc, a clinical-stage precision oncology company, develops novel targeted therapies for RAS-addicted cancers. The company's research and development pipeline comprises RAS(ON) inhibitors designed to be used as monotherapy in combination with other RAS(ON) inhibitors and/or in combination with RAS companion inhibitors or other therapeutic agents, and RAS companion inhibitors for combination treatment strategies.
